Morocco's first locally-created electric car to be sold at affordable price

ALBAWABA - Moroccan company "Neo Motors" is preparing to launch the first locally manufactured electric car in the history of the country at an affordable price. The Moroccan first electric car will be sold at about 100,000 Moroccan dirhams (around $10,740), starting in 2026.
